The ingredients needed to make My Poached Smoked Haddock Fillets in Green Beans:
  1. Prepare 4 Frozen Smoked Haddock Fillets
  2. Get 1/4 cup water
  3. Get 1/4 cup Parsley
  4. Prepare Pinch salt
  5. Take 2 tbls lemon juice
  6. Make ready 1/2 tsp Black pepper
  7. Take Lemon parsley sauce
  8. Get 1/2 cup milk
  9. Prepare 1 tsp butter
  10. Prepare Pinch salt
  11. Prepare 2 basil leaves broken up
  12. Get 1 tsp dried or fresh parsley

Instructions to make My Poached Smoked Haddock Fillets in Green Beans:
  1. In a non stick frying pan with a lid add the water heat to boil
  2. Next add the yellow fish pinch Salt and 1 cup Greek Beans and pepper
  3. Add the lemon and let it simmer for 5 - 10 minutes
  4. The sauce. Mix 2 tsp flour in 1/2 cup milk and stir to mix
  5. Add the butter stir then add to a small saucepan
  6. Heat up slowly and stir add the salt n pepper and stir in
  7. Add 1 tsp dried parsley and stir to mix in keep stirring
  8. Next carefully pour some of the liquid that the fish is cooked in about 6 tbls full mix in should be thick.
  9. Now add 2 tbls lemon juice and stir
  10. Add the Basil leaves and chop small stir in.
  11. Simmer.5 minutes
  12. Add the fish and green beans to the serving plate and serve with some lovely boiled jersey potatoes just add 2 or 3 spoonfuls of the sauce to the plate is enough.
  13. Serve hot.
